3. Regional and local variability in the spatial distribution of cobaltrich<br />

ferromanganese crusts in the world’s ocean<br />

Dr. Yubko’s presentation was on the regional and local variability in<br />

the spatial distribution of cobalt-rich ferromanganese crusts in the world’s<br />

Oceans. At the outset he mentioned that the study of cobalt-rich<br />

ferromanganese crusts has reached a stage that justifies addressing the issue<br />

from the point of view of exploration and subsequently exploitation. Dr.<br />

Yubko stated that after research initiated in the 1970s, a number of scientific<br />

and commercial companies from France, Germany, Japan, Russia and the<br />

United States had been engaged in active research.<br />

He informed the workshop that the first Russian study was carried out<br />

on separate guyots of the Marcus-Neccer of the Central Pacific Ridge in 1968<br />

and 1970 using the research vessel Vitiaz. He explained that ever since, a<br />

number of cruises have been carried out and valuable data including<br />

published data are available. He pointed out that the information in the<br />

Russian database has been incorporated in different kinds of maps- namely,<br />

bathymetric, geological and the metallogenic. He explained that a typical<br />

ferromanganese crusts ore field might have dimensions of 120 km to 80 km at<br />

the base with depth intervals of 1300m to 1500m. He pointed out that the<br />

guyot, where the Russian study was conducted, an associated structure whose<br />

base is at a depth of 3,000 m has complicated this particular ore field. The<br />

average slopes have a dip range of 20 o to 30 o . He also explained that the<br />

parameters for making a commercial decision about the ore field were<br />

controlled by the thickness, structure and composition of the crusts.<br />

4. Hydrothermal sulphide mineralisation of the Atlantic – Results of<br />

Russian investigations, 1985-2000<br />

The results of Russian investigations on hydrothermal sulphide<br />

mineralization in the Atlantic were presented in a paper prepared by Dr.<br />

Cherkashev. In his paper, Dr. Cherkasev states that fourteen (14)<br />

hydrothermal fields were studied by the Russian Federation in the Pacific and<br />

Atlantic Oceans using the submersibles Pisces and Mir. Studies were<br />

conducted at the Rainbow, Lucky Strike and Logachev hydrothermal fields.<br />
